I have an EG project that runs fine but I need to create a stored process which is to be executed by the user from the SAS add-in.

What do I have to change in the ODS statement to route the .xls file to the EXCEL session?

The SAS Add-in for Microsoft Office can ONLY receive CSV results, HTML results and SASReport XML results (the type of output created by EG). Excel, using the Add-in, CANNOT open TAGSETS.EXCELXP output. There are many previous forum postings about how to "workaround" this but they all involve using the Information Delivery Portal or the Stored Process Web App to execute the STored Process.
